Default SV 6 set up snags

I've just attempted to set up my shiny new SV6 box but I've hit a few snags already.

Does the box need to be connected to the net BEFORE it's updated or after? If it's before I have 2 problems.

1 The CD I got with the econnect home plugs doesn't work and
2 I only have one compatible plug at the back of the modem which the blue ethernet cable goes into. I need an extra plug for the cable from the home plug (do they do a double adapter?)

Any thoughts/advice most welcome!

Default Re: SV 6 set up snags

you put the software on the box first then scan the box, after you have that done you connect your ethernet cable, but as you are using hom plugs follow below

plug to wall ethernet cable from plug to ROUTER, other plug beside box in wall cable from plug to box job done.
